oeqa: tear down oeqa decorators if one of them raises an exception in setup
Some of the decorators need proper cleanup, such as OETimeout which sets a signal handler that needs to be cleared via teardown. If this is not done then the signal gets called later with unpredictable effects. This can be seen if there's a test that is skipped via a decorator and sets a timeout at the same time: the timeout isn't cleared, and is invoked later in a completely unrelated context.
